- Function: It connects feeder cables or distribution cables to subscriber drop cables, often utilizing PLC splitters for efficient distribution.
- Applications: Used in various FTTx network points, including aerial networks with pre-terminated drop cables, and FTTH networks as access points or floor boxes.
- Features: Integrates fiber splicing, splitting, distribution, storage, and cable connection in a protective enclosure, typically made of plastic (like ABS) for outdoor wall-mounted applications.
- Capacity: Available in different capacities, with this type often configured with splice trays for multiple fiber cores (e.g., 48 cores with 4 splice trays).
